About Michael Karampelas

Michael Karampelas is a scholar working on Ophthalmology,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ging and Nephrology, having authored 24 papers that have together received 773 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Retinal Diseases and Treatments (15 papers), Retinal and Optic Conditions (11 papers) and Retinal Imaging and Analysis (9 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Ophthalmology (695 citations),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(441 citations) and Rheumatology (33 citations). Michael Karampelas has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, Greece and United States. Frequent co-authors include Pearse A. Keane, Dawn A. Sim, Carlos Pavésio, Adnan Tufail, Kara-Anne Tan, Mohammed Salman, Rupesh Agrawal, Marcus Fruttiger, Catherine Egan and Richard Lee.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, PLoS ONE and Ophthalmology.
